It looked to me like Edmunds got the short end on a few dive options during the game. If there was a hole, then Logan kept the ball. If there was no hole, then Logan handed off for Edmunds to try to make something out of nothing. If Logan hands off on a few of those plays where there was room to run, then Edmunds gains a lot more yards in the game.
